Feature request to add 2 new variables to raise errors on queries that select from empty or non-existent partitions, eg:
{code}set hive.error.select.non-existent.partition=true;
SELECT * FROM myTable WHERE date='2015-02-29';
<raise some error here>
{code}
Currently the behaviour is to return success with zero rows, which doesn't make practical sense in many cases, and I only detected this because my bulk jobs started completing too quickly. I work around this now by listing all partitions and then checking against that before launching the bulk job but it would be more convenient to have the query just fail as is logical in these sorts of scenarios.

There should also be a similar variable for selecting from empty partitions for people who expect their partitions to be populated (a very common expectation), such as:
{code}hive.error.select.empty.partition{code}
This is somewhat similar to the existing variable
{code}hive.error.on.empty.partition{code}
except this existing one only covers dynamic partition inserts that generate empty partitions, so the suggested query side variable would be a logical counterpart to that.

Having these variables as 'false' by default these would make these completely backwards compatible improvements.
